PDF文件转换成PPT或EXCEL一直是让人比较头疼的问题,要么下载专业的PDF转换软件,如Adobe Acrobat,这些软件基本都要订阅付费才能使用。 要么使用在线转换工具,也大多需要注册会员,付费使用,且文件需要在线上传存在隐私泄密风险。 而会python则可以轻易解决这些问题,使用python的一些第三方库来辅助完成这个任务。 以下是使用sp...
然后将代码保存到某个python文件例如"pdf2ppt.py"中,将该文件和需要转化的pdf放在一起,在命令行执行: python .\pdf2ppt.py 文件名 300 16x9 其中文件名无需'.pdf'后缀,300指的是转化成图片的dpi,后面的16x9指的是屏幕的比例。 通过这次调研,发现也可以通过对markdown的解析,利用python-pptx生成ppt,相对beam...
方法2: 使用 PyMuPDF 和 python-pptx 如果您想要更灵活地控制转换过程,可以使用 PyMuPDF 读取 PDF 文件,并使用 python-pptx 创建 PPT 文件。 步骤1: 安装库 安装所需的库: pip install PyMuPDF python-pptx 步骤2: 转换 PDF 为 PPT 以下是使用 PyMuPDF 和 python-pptx 的示例代码: import fitz # PyMuPDF fr...
通过以上步骤,我们可以将PDF文件转换为PPT文件。首先,我们需要安装pdf2image和python-pptx两个库。然后,将PDF转换为图片文件,并创建一个空的PPT文件。接着,将图片文件插入到PPT中,并保存PPT文件。这样,我们就成功实现了Python中PDF转PPT的功能。 PDF转PPT实现方法 希望本文对你理解如何使用Python实现PDF转PPT有所帮助。
python中pdf转cdf python中pdf转ppt 前言:在这里并不是将PDF中的文字和图片转为相对应的PPT,只是简单的把PDF作为图片插入到PPT中! 最终呈现的效果如下图: 话不多说,直接开干! 第一步:先写出PDF转PPT的代码。 import os import fitz import pptx from pptx.util import Inches...
# 1. 打开PDF文件并将其转换为图像 pdf_file = '非肿瘤多芯片联合分析.pdf' images = convert_from_path(pdf_file) # 2. 创建一个PPT ppt = Presentation() # 3. 逐页添加图像到PPT for i, image in enumerate(images): # 创建一个新的PPT页 ...
在Python中,我们可以使用PyMuPDF和pptx模块来实现将PDF文件转换为PPT文件的功能。 PyMuPDF是一个用于处理PDF文件的Python库,而pptx是一个用于创建和修改PPT文件的库。 首先,我们需要安装PyMuPDF和pptx模块。可以使用以下命令来安装这两个模块: 复制 pip install PyMuPDF ...
合并重复的内容等;在转换后对PPT文件进行调整和优化,如调整布局、字体、颜色等。Q:如何使用Python实现PDF转PPT?A:使用Python实现PDF转PPT需要具备一定的编程基础。可以参考以下步骤:安装Python环境;安装pdf2image、poppler-utils等库;编写脚本读取PDF文件,将图片转换为PPT格式;保存生成的PPT文件。
对于需要批量处理的技术型选手,可以试试这个Python脚本: import pdf2pptxconverter = pdf2pptx.Converter("input.pdf")converter.convert("output.pptx", resolution=300) 通过调整DPI参数控制图像质量,还能用PDF转PPT元素提取功能单独获取矢量元素。这种方案特别适合需要集成到自动化工作流的开发者。